In the Excel,or spreadsheet,approach to recording financial transactions,direct labor paid in cash is recorded as a decrease in the Cash column and as an increase in the Work in Process column.
Operating Leverage
A measure of how revenue growth translates into growth in operating income, highlighting the impact of fixed costs.
